New ballast for NanoCube HQI
My ballast died (again) on my 28 Nanocube HQI, this time out of warranty... So I'm in the market for a new one.
I'm looking at the Aqua Medic Reeflex ballast right now, would this be a simple plug and play swap out or would it involve cutting any wires? |

Mostl likely need to splice some wires, the female plug on the ballast is an unusual one and I dont even think it comes with it. Hellolights has some better info of what is needed.
